Jennifer Anne Long was born in April 1975.
11 Aug 2016
Appointment
11 Aug 2016
Significant Control
11 Apr 2014
Appointment
12 Aug 2011
Appointment
21 Jul 2011
Appointment
14 Apr 2011
Resignation
25 Jan 2010
Appointment
14 Nov 2009
Resignation
14 Nov 2009
Resignation
29 Oct 2008
Appointment
26 Feb 2007
Appointment
24 Apr 2006
Appointment
16 Jun 2004
Appointment
31 Oct 2002
Appointment